Abstract
This essay introduces the papers from the specially organized session on the theme 'The 2012 phenomenon: Maya calendar, astronomy, and apocalypticism in the worlds of scholarship and popular culture'. The papers that follow address this topical theme in the contexts of Maya and Western cultures as well as academic and popular cultures. © International Astronomical Union 2011.
